#e1f678 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e1f678 is composed of 88.2% red, 96.5%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 8.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 51.2%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 70 degrees, a saturation of 87.5% and a lightness of 71.8%. #e1f678 color hex could be obtained by blending #fffff0 with #c3ed00. Closest websafe color is: #ccff66.

Shades and Tints of #e1f678

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0c01 is the darkest color, while #fefff9 is the lightest one.
